Accounts Receivable

Workday, Inc. Accounts Receivable increased by 33.3% to $2.33B in Q4 2025 compared to the prior quarter. Year-over-year, this metric grew by 19.6%, from $1.95B to $2.33B. Over 5 years (FY 2020 to FY 2025), Accounts Receivable shows an upward trend with a 17.7% CAGR.

How to read this metric

Rapid growth relative to sales may indicate collection issues or aggressive revenue recognition; stability suggests efficient cash conversion.
